About Tuncay Tunç
Tuncay Tunç is a scholar working on Inorganic Chemistry, Organic Chemistry and Oncology, having authored 48 papers that have together received 576 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Metal complexes synthesis and properties (13 papers), Crystal structures of chemical compounds (11 papers) and Semiconductor materials and interfaces (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(194 citations), Polymers and Plastics (85 citations) and Organic Chemistry (146 citations). Tuncay Tunç has collaborated with scholars based in Türkiye, Iran and Austria. Frequent co-authors include İbrahım Uslu, Ş. Altındal, Habibe Uslu, Ïlbilge Dökme, Musa Sarı, Arda Aytimur, Selda Keskin, Ümmühan Özdemir Özmen, Muharrem Gökçen and Ertan Şahi̇n. Their work appears in journals such as Tetrahedron, Journal of Applied Polymer Science and Spectrochimica Acta Part A Molecular and Biomolecular Spectroscopy.
